Born in 1911, she was ill through much of high school and never attained a high school diploma. Instead, she began\u00a0journaling, learning nature on an intimate level, then developing a \u2018nature news\u2019 publication that she distributed around her neighborhood. At 17, she was asked to write a column in this same style for one of the largest newspapers in Illinois, and by the time she was 19 she was asked to create, write, illustrate and edit a monthly magazine for the Illinois State Museum. She continued with this effort for 326 issues until 1966 and her early tragic death at age 56. It seemed Virginia knew she had little time &#8211; and let none of it pass unproductively.
